1. Define Kirchoff's first and second laws.

2. A mine has a total airflow requirement of 248 m3/s. If the equivalent resistance of the workings is 0.09 Ns2/m8 determine the pressure to be developed by a single mine fan to ventilate the workings.

3. A working area of a mine has diesel equipment operating within it. The maximum diesel loading is 350 kW. The same section of the mine also has a methane inflow of 0.65 m3/s flowing into it. If the maximum permissible methane concentration in the general body of the air is 1% and the design diesel air quantity is 6 m3/s per 100 kW of installed diesel power, determine the required ventilation flow rate for the working area.

1398_Basic Ventilation Calculations1.png

Figure 1: Fan Characteristic curve

4. Determine the characteristic curves for the fan illustrated in figure 1 for the following cases:
• Two fans in series
• Two fans in parallel

5. A worker in a development drive is working at a rate of 250 W/m2. If the air velocity passing over the worker is 1.5 m/s, the air dry bulb temperature is 35°C, the air wet bulb temperature is 33°C, radiant temperature of the surroundings is 35°C, and it can be assumed that the worker's skin temperature is 34 °C, determine:

• The air cooling power
• The basic effective temperature

Is the environment safe to work in?
